1.Applying National Whole-genome Sequencing Findings for Rare Diseases in Clinical Practice: The Imperative of a Multidisciplinary Approach
Kyung Sun PARK ; Sunghwan SHIN ; Jong-Ho PARK ; Young-Eun KIM ; Won Kyung KWON ; Min-Kyung SO ; Changhee HA ; Ja-Hyun JANG ; Taeheon LEE ; Chang-Seok KI ; Yoonjung KIM ; Kyung-A LEE ; Inho PARK ; Sejoon LEE ; Hong-Hee WON ; ; Jong-Won KIM
Annals of Laboratory Medicine 2026;46(1):94-103
Background:
As nationwide government-led whole-genome sequencing (WGS) projects progress, optimizing the clinical integration of large-scale WGS results is crucial. We explored how the initial analysis from Korea’s First WGS Pilot Study for Rare Diseases was applied in clinical practice, and then we reanalyzed the data comprehensively at Samsung Medical Center (SMC) Seoul, Korea.
Methods:
A prospective cohort study designed to collect WGS data under a Korean national initiative was conducted from August 2020 to December 2021. We focused on patients with rare diseases recruited from 16 university hospitals. The participants included 5,000 individuals (2,200 probands and 2,800 family members). The initial WGS data and diagnostic reference reports (from 682 probands and 484 family members), generated based on the First Korean WGS Pilot Study for Rare Diseases, were subsequently reanalyzed by SMC.
Results:
The initial analysis of the First Korean WGS Pilot Study data revealed a diagnostic rate of 17%. Upon receiving these results, the SMC conducted two rounds of reanalysis, increasing the diagnostic rate from 15% in the first analysis, to 18% in the second, and finally to 24% in the third (P = 1.6 × 10 −5 ). Key factors in improving the genetic diagnosis included increased detection of novel (likely) pathogenic variants (P = 1.0 × 10 −4 ), improved diagnostic rates with larger family recruitment (P = 0.004), and refined clinical information for more precise genotype–phenotype correlation analysis (40%).
Conclusions
Although national WGS projects lay a foundation for rare disease diagnosis, hospital-level reanalysis and multidisciplinary collaborations are crucial for optimizing diagnostic outcomes.
2.Comparison of Digital Mammography Plus Full ABUS Review and Digital Mammography Plus Selective ABUS Review Guided by ABUS Artificial Intelligence–Computer-Aided Diagnosis for Breast Cancer Screening
Inyoung YOUN ; Su Min HA ; Myoung-jin JANG ; Mi-ri KWON ; Jung Min CHANG
Korean Journal of Radiology 2026;27(2):111-121
Objective:
To compare two breast cancer screening strategies, digital mammography (DM) plus radiologist-interpreted automated breast ultrasound (ABUS) and DM plus selective ABUS review, in which only examinations positive for DM or flagged by ABUS artificial intelligence–computer-aided diagnosis (AI-CAD) were reviewed by radiologists.
Materials and Methods:
This retrospective study included asymptomatic women who underwent DM and ABUS screening for breast cancer between March 2022 and March 2023. The radiologists’ interpretations of DM and ABUS without AI assistance (DM + ABUS_radiologist) were collected from the clinical radiology reports. A selective DM plus ABUS reading strategy was simulated, in which only cases interpreted as positive in the radiologist’s DM report or flagged by retrospectively applied ABUS AI-CAD were triaged for further evaluation through a full review by radiologists (DM + ABUS_AI-CAD). The cancer detection rate (CDR), sensitivity, specificity, and abnormal interpretation rate (AIR) were calculated and compared between DM + ABUS_ radiologist and DM + ABUS_AI-CAD groups using the McNemar’s test.
Results:
Among 2,275 women (mean age, 56.1 ± 8.6 years), 12 cancers were diagnosed. The sensitivity, CDR and AIR for DM + ABUS_radiologist was 83.3% (10/12; 95% confidence interval [CI]: 51.6–97.9), 4.4 (10/2,275; 95% CI: 2.1–8.1) per 1,000 screening examinations and 16.7% (379/2,275; 95% CI: 15.1–18.3), respectively. DM + ABUS_AI-CAD triaged 84.0% (1,910/2,275) of the examinations as negative in both DM reports and retrospectively applied ABUS AI-CAD, requiring radiologist reassessment in only 16.0% (365/2,275). This approach reduced the AIR to 7.3% (167/2,275) and improved the specificity from 83.7% (1,894/2,263) to 93.1% (2,107/2,263) (all P < 0.001), while maintaining a CDR of 4.8 per 1,000 and a sensitivity of 91.7% (11/12) (all P > 0.999), compared to the DM + ABUS-radiologist.
Conclusion
An AI-CAD-assisted selective ABUS reading strategy reduces unnecessary recalls and improves specificity, which may help optimize reading priorities and reduce the reading workload while maintaining cancer detection performance.
3.Development of a no-contact health promotion behavior program for the digital generation: A simplified one-group pretest/posttest design for nursing students
Myoung-Lyun HEO ; Seung-Ha KIM ; Chang-Sik NOH ; Yang-Min JANG
Journal of Korean Academic Society of Nursing Education 2025;31(1):84-95
Purpose:
This study aimed to develop a no-contact health promotion behavior program for nursing students as representatives of young adults and to evaluate its effects and applicability.
Methods:
We employed a one-group pretest/posttest design to develop a no-contact health promotion behavior program for young adults and to assess its impacts on post-pandemic health promotion behavior, health self-efficacy, depression, and stress among nursing students. Using an online ad, we recruited young adults aged 19 to 29 living in South Korea who were attending nursing school; those who provided informed consent to participate in the study were enrolled.
Results:
The no-contact health promotion behavior program was effective at improving health promotion behavior (Z=-2.90, p=.004) and health self-efficacy (Z=-2.24, p=.025) and at alleviating depression (Z=-2.13, p=.033).
Conclusion
This study confirmed the potential of a no-contact program to advance health management among young adults. It also substantiated the program’s effects on fostering experiences and promoting personal health among nursing students, who are prospective healthcare professionals.

6.Gender and Menopause Impact on Recurrence and Cancer-Specific Mortality in Bladder Cancer After Radical Cystectomy: A Retrospective Cohort Study
Jee Soo PARK ; Won Sik JANG ; Jieun HEO ; Won Sik HAM ; Kyung Hwan KIM ; Jong Kil NAM ; Bum-Jin LIM ; Bum Sik HONG ; Wook NAM ; Sangchul LEE ; Jong Jin OH ; Seung Hwan JEONG ; Ja Hyeon KU ; Tae Il NOH ; Sung Gu KANG ; Seok Ho KANG ; Yun-Sok HA ; Tae Gyun KWON ; Tae‑Hwan KIM ; Jongchan KIM ; Geehyun SONG ; Ho Kyung SEO ; Wan SONG ; Hyun Hwan SUNG ; Byong Chang JEONG
Journal of Urologic Oncology 2025;23(1):88-93
Purpose:
Although bladder cancer occurs three to 4 times more frequently in men than in women, the relative number of deaths compared to incidence is higher in women, suggesting that women have a worse prognosis than men. Emerging evidence indicates that the activity of the sex steroid hormone pathway may play a role in bladder cancer development, with demonstrations that both androgens and estrogens have biological effects on bladder cancer in vitro and in vivo. This study investigates the influence of sex and menopausal status on recurrence and cancer-specific death (CSD) in bladder cancer patients undergoing radical cystectomy (RC).
Materials and Methods:
This retrospective analysis included 3,913 patients from the Korean Bladder Cancer Study Group Database who underwent RC between 2010 and 2019. Patients were categorized based on gender and menopausal status (≤50 years: premenopausal; >50 years: postmenopausal). Pathological factors, neoadjuvant chemotherapy, recurrence, and CSD rates were analyzed using chi-square and Fisher exact tests.
Results:
Among the 3,913 patients, 400 (10.2%) were female. Premenopausal females exhibited significantly lower recurrence rates (28.6%) compared to postmenopausal females (45.7%). CSD rates were similarly reduced in premenopausal females (12.0% vs. 22.2% in postmenopausal females). No significant sex differences in recurrence or CSD were observed among premenopausal patients. Pathological T stage, nodal status, and lymphovascular invasion were significantly associated with recurrence in males, while nodal status alone was significant in females. Neoadjuvant chemotherapy was significantly more frequently administered to male patients under the age of 50, while no difference was observed in the administration of neoadjuvant chemotherapy among female patients based on menopausal status.
Conclusion
Hormonal changes associated with menopause significantly influence bladder cancer outcomes in women. Premenopausal hormonal environments seem protective, underscoring the need for further research into hormone-driven mechanisms in bladder cancer.
7.Simultaneous Viability Assessment and Invasive Coronary Angiography Using a Therapeutic CT System in Chronic Myocardial Infarction Patients
Seongmin HA ; Yeonggul JANG ; Byoung Kwon LEE ; Youngtaek HONG ; Byeong-Keuk KIM ; Seil PARK ; Sun Kook YOO ; Hyuk-Jae CHANG
Yonsei Medical Journal 2024;65(5):257-264
Purpose:
In a preclinical study using a swine myocardial infarction (MI) model, a delayed enhancement (DE)-multi-detector computed tomography (MDCT) scan was performed using a hybrid system alongside diagnostic invasive coronary angiography (ICA) without the additional use of a contrast agent, and demonstrated an excellent correlation in the infarct area compared with histopathologic specimens. In the present investigation, we evaluated the feasibility and diagnostic accuracy of a myocardial viability assessment by DE-MDCT using a hybrid system comprising ICA and MDCT alongside diagnostic ICA without the additional use of a contrast agent.
Materials and Methods:
We prospectively enrolled 13 patients (median age: 67 years) with a previous MI (>6 months) scheduled to undergo ICA. All patients underwent cardiac magnetic resonance (CMR) imaging before diagnostic ICA. MDCT viability scans were performed concurrently with diagnostic ICA without the use of additional contrast. The total myocardial scar volume per patient and average transmurality per myocardial segment measured by DE-MDCT were compared with those from DE-CMR.
Results:
The DE volume measured by MDCT showed an excellent correlation with the volume measured by CMR (r=0.986, p<0.0001). The transmurality per segment by MDCT was well-correlated with CMR (r=0.900, p<0.0001); the diagnostic performance of MDCT in differentiating non-viable from viable myocardium using a 50% transmurality criterion was good with a sensitivity, specificity, positive predictive value, negative predictive value, and accuracy of 87.5%, 99.5%, 87.5%, 99.5%, and 99.1%, respectively.
Conclusion
The feasibility of the DE-MDCT viability assessment acquired simultaneously with conventional ICA was proven in patients with chronic MI using DE-CMR as the reference standard.
8.Quantitative Analysis of the Effect of Stereotactic Radiosurgery for Postoperative Residual Cervical Dumbbell Tumors: A Multicenter Retrospective Cohort Study
Sang Hyub LEE ; Sun Woo JANG ; Hong Kyung SHIN ; Jeoung Hee KIM ; Danbi PARK ; Chang-Min HA ; Sun-Ho LEE ; Dong Ho KANG ; Young Hyun CHO ; Sang Ryong JEON ; Sung Woo ROH ; Jin Hoon PARK
Neurospine 2024;21(1):293-302
Objective:
Stereotactic radiosurgery (SRS) has been performed for spinal tumors. However, the quantitative effect of SRS on postoperative residual cervical dumbbell tumors remains unknown. This study aimed to quantitatively evaluate the efficacy of SRS for treating postoperative residual cervical dumbbell tumors.
Methods:
We retrospectively reviewed cases of postoperative residual cervical dumbbell tumors from 1995 to 2020 in 2 tertiary institutions. Residual tumors underwent SRS (SRS group) or were observed with clinical and magnetic resonance imaging (MRI) follow-up (observation group). Tumor regrowth rates were compared between the SRS and observation groups. Additionally, risk factors for tumor regrowth were analyzed.
Results:
A total of 28 cervical dumbbell tumors were incompletely resected. Eight patients were in the SRS group, and 20 in the observation group. The mean regrowth rate was not significantly lower (p = 0.784) in the SRS group (0.18 ± 0.29 mm/mo) than in the observation group (0.33 ± 0.40 mm/mo). In the multivariable Cox regression analysis, SRS was not a significant variable (hazard ratio [HR], 0.57; 95% confidence interval [CI], 0.18–1.79; p = 0.336).
Conclusion
SRS did not significantly decrease the tumor regrowth rate in our study. We believe that achieving maximal resection during the initial operation is more important than postoperative adjuvant SRS.
9.Colon cancer: the 2023 Korean clinical practice guidelines for diagnosis and treatment
Hyo Seon RYU ; Hyun Jung KIM ; Woong Bae JI ; Byung Chang KIM ; Ji Hun KIM ; Sung Kyung MOON ; Sung Il KANG ; Han Deok KWAK ; Eun Sun KIM ; Chang Hyun KIM ; Tae Hyung KIM ; Gyoung Tae NOH ; Byung-Soo PARK ; Hyeung-Min PARK ; Jeong Mo BAE ; Jung Hoon BAE ; Ni Eun SEO ; Chang Hoon SONG ; Mi Sun AHN ; Jae Seon EO ; Young Chul YOON ; Joon-Kee YOON ; Kyung Ha LEE ; Kyung Hee LEE ; Kil-Yong LEE ; Myung Su LEE ; Sung Hak LEE ; Jong Min LEE ; Ji Eun LEE ; Han Hee LEE ; Myong Hoon IHN ; Je-Ho JANG ; Sun Kyung JEON ; Kum Ju CHAE ; Jin-Ho CHOI ; Dae Hee PYO ; Gi Won HA ; Kyung Su HAN ; Young Ki HONG ; Chang Won HONG ; Jung-Myun KWAK ;
Annals of Coloproctology 2024;40(2):89-113
Colorectal cancer is the third most common cancer in Korea and the third leading cause of death from cancer. Treatment outcomes for colon cancer are steadily improving due to national health screening programs with advances in diagnostic methods, surgical techniques, and therapeutic agents.. The Korea Colon Cancer Multidisciplinary (KCCM) Committee intends to provide professionals who treat colon cancer with the most up-to-date, evidence-based practice guidelines to improve outcomes and help them make decisions that reflect their patients’ values and preferences. These guidelines have been established by consensus reached by the KCCM Guideline Committee based on a systematic literature review and evidence synthesis and by considering the national health insurance system in real clinical practice settings. Each recommendation is presented with a recommendation strength and level of evidence based on the consensus of the committee.
10.Clinical Outcomes of Solid Organ Transplant Recipients Hospitalized with COVID-19: A Propensity Score-Matched Cohort Study
Jeong-Hoon LIM ; Eunkyung NAM ; Yu Jin SEO ; Hee-Yeon JUNG ; Ji-Young CHOI ; Jang-Hee CHO ; Sun-Hee PARK ; Chan-Duck KIM ; Yong-Lim KIM ; Sohyun BAE ; Soyoon HWANG ; Yoonjung KIM ; Hyun-Ha CHANG ; Shin-Woo KIM ; Juhwan JUNG ; Ki Tae KWON
Infection and Chemotherapy 2024;56(3):329-338
Background:
Solid-organ transplant recipients (SOTRs) receiving immunosuppressive therapy are expected to have worse clinical outcomes from coronavirus disease 2019 (COVID-19). However, published studies have shown mixed results, depending on adjustment for important confounders such as age, variants, and vaccination status.
Materials and Methods:
We retrospectively collected the data on 7,327 patients hospitalized with COVID-19 from two tertiary hospitals with government-designated COVID-19 regional centers. We compared clinical outcomes between SOTRs and non-SOTRs by a propensity score-matched analysis (1:2) based on age, gender, and the date of COVID-19 diagnosis. We also performed a multivariate logistic regression analysis to adjust other important confounders such as vaccination status and the Charlson comorbidity index.
Results:
After matching, SOTRs (n=83) had a significantly higher risk of high-flow nasal cannula use, mechanical ventilation, acute kidney injury, and a composite of COVID-19 severity outcomes than non-SOTRs (n=160) (all P <0.05). The National Early Warning Score was significantly higher in SOTRs than in non-SOTRs from day 1 to 7 of hospitalization ( P for interaction=0.008 by generalized estimating equation). In multivariate logistic regression analysis, SOTRs (odds ratio [OR], 2.14; 95% confidence interval [CI], 1.12–4.11) and male gender (OR, 2.62; 95% CI, 1.26– 5.45) were associated with worse outcomes, and receiving two to three doses of COVID-19 vaccine (OR, 0.43; 95% CI, 0.24–0.79) was associated with better outcomes.
Conclusion
Hospitalized SOTRs with COVID-19 had a worse prognosis than non-SOTRs. COVID-19 vaccination should be implemented appropriately to prevent severe COVID-19 progression in this population.
